Specs That Win Wars (Not Marketing Awards)

  • Power: 60V FLEXVOLT ADVANTAGE® (runs on 20V batteries)
  • Cutting Path: 15" (vs. 13" on Milwaukee & Ego)
  • Line Speed: 7,300 RPM (25% faster than Ego POWER+)
  • Weight: 10.9 lbs (loaded) | Runtime: 90+ min (9.0Ah)
  • Special: 0.095" Bump Head + Commercial Guard
  • Vibration: 4.1 m/s² (OSHA-approved for 8-hr shifts)

Flaw-Killing Fixes From The Trenches

1️⃣ Trigger Lockover Fatigue

  • Issue: Thumb soreness after 6+ hours
  • Fix: Ergodyne Proflex 819 Gloves + rotate crews

2️⃣ High Grass Stalling

  • *Issue:** 18"+ weeds occasionally bind head
  • *Fix: DeWalt HARDWOOD Blade Conversion Kit** ($39)

3️⃣ Battery Confusion

  • Issue: Mixing 20V/60V batteries confuses new crews
  • Fix: Color-coded stickers + Power Detect® training

4️⃣ Guard Gap Debris

  • Issue: Small stones ricochet off pavers
  • *Fix: Homemade wire mesh insert** (field upgrade)
